html来回移动代码实现

要实现HTML元素来回移动的效果,您可以使用CSS3的动画和关键帧(keyframes)来创建动态效果。以下是一个示例代码,演示如何使用CSS3实现HTML元素来回移动:

<!DOCTYPE html>
<html>
<head>
	<title>来回移动的元素</title>
	<style>
		@keyframes move {
			0% {
				transform: translateX(0);
			}
			50% {
				transform: translateX(200px);
			}
			100% {
				transform: translateX(0);
			}
		}
		.box {
			width: 100px;
			height: 100px;
			background-color: red;
			animation: move 2s linear infinite;
		}
	</style>
</head>
<body>
	<div class="box"></div>
</body>
</html>

在这个html来回移动代码中,我们首先使用@keyframes规则来定义一个名为move的关键帧。在这个关键帧中,我们使用transform属性来实现元素的平移,从而使元素在X轴上来回移动。在0%50%100%的关键帧位置,我们使用不同的transform值来定义元素的位置。

接下来,我们使用CSS的animation属性来将动画应用于元素。我们将move关键帧作为动画的值,并设置动画的持续时间为2秒(2s),速度为线性(linear),重复次数为无限(infinite)。最后,我们创建一个名为box<div>元素,并将其样式设置为具有100像素宽度和高度的红色正方形,将动画应用于该元素。

请注意,这只是一个示例代码,您可以根据需要更改样式和动画的属性,以创建不同的效果。

猜你喜欢:

PHP实现仿手机QQ窗口抖动代码分享

c++仿手机qq窗口抖动代码